Decathlon

Decathlon is one of the biggest sports retailers in the world. They sell equipment for over 70 different sports, including surf boards and mountain bikes, all under one roof. They are committed in making sport accessible to everyone, regardless of age or athletic ability. This includes affordable pricing as well as simple and user-friendly products.

The company is also playing with new technologies, including RFID, which enables employees to concentrate on providing customer service and guidance. This technology also makes it easier for shoppers to find what they're searching for.

Decathlon and Emersya collaborated for its Reveal Innovation Event to create polygonal 3D models of 16 innovations in product design. They also created interactive 3D experiences for product discovery on the web. The digital versions were embedded on the website of Decathlon so that anyone who missed the event could still access them. The events were a huge success and were also used to enhance the company's onsite notifications with relevant, individualized engagement.

House of Fraser

House of Fraser is a department store chain in the United Kingdom. It was established in Glasgow in Scotland in 1849. A series of acquisitions has made it one the largest retailers in the UK. By the end of the 1980s, it was home to more than 90 stores. It was becoming less popular with British consumers who were moving from large department stores to smaller, less trendy shops.

In the 1990s, House of Fraser started a program of renovation and downsizing its stores. It also opened new stores. The company was hoping to buy smaller rival Allders however, the deal was never completed.

Under the leadership of Mike Ashley, the company has undergone a series of changes. It has, for instance, introduced augmented reality on its magazine covers and catalogues. This feature allows readers to scan the cover using their smartphones and see virtual versions of the clothing and other products mentioned in the article. It also has the "shoppable window" feature.

John Lewis

John Lewis is the UK's most renowned department store chain, with stores in England and Scotland. The company's flagship store is located in Birmingham's Grand Central shopping centre. The store is a massive 250,000 square feet floor space and houses the John Lewis own-brand range.

The company was established in 1864 when John Spedan Lewis opened his first textile shop in Oxford Street, London. Today the John Lewis Partnership is one of the largest companies owned by employees. It owns Waitrose and John Lewis department stores as along with a number of suburban and province department stores.

The Partnership has had a difficult time recovering from the expansion it experienced in the 2000s, a time that saw it compete with discount retailers such as Lidl and Aldi. Dame Sharon White oversaw a turnaround plan and CEO Nish Knkiwala has promised to "focus without shame" on retail. The company is investing in the latest digital technology. The chain is known for its excellent customer service and for the high salaries of its employees.
